- I'm finding that the IoLinc 2450 does not always show proper relay condition if using Momentary settings. I will put a proper post shortly, but in the meantime;
Until IoLinc wrong response bug is fixed, here is a workaround.
When using IoLinc in Momentary mode, include this program; Relay Workaround
If Control 'Garage Relay' is not switched Off Or Status 'Garage Relay' is not Off Then Wait 1 second Set 'Garage Relay' Off
